UN 2030: Hydrazine, aqueous solution
DOT Classification and Shipping
UN 2030 is assigned the proper shipping name Hydrazine, aqueous solution in the U.S. DOT Hazardous Materials Table (49 CFR 172.101). It is classified as a Class 8 Corrosive material, Packing Group I. Required label(s): 8, 6.1.
Packing group indicates the degree of danger within a hazard class: PG I is high danger, PG II medium, PG III low. The proper shipping name, hazard class, UN number, and packing group together form the basic shipping description that must appear on shipping papers and, where required, on the package and placard.
Emergency Response (ERG Guide 153)
Hazards: TOXIC. Combustible. Corrosive. Causes burns. Toxic fumes when heated.
Fire: Small: dry chemical, CO2, water spray. Large: water spray, foam.
Spill: Do not touch. Stop leak if safe. Use water spray to reduce vapor.
Chemical and Physical Properties
Hydrazine, anhydrous appears as a colorless, fuming oily liquid with an ammonia-like odor. Flash point 99 °F. Explodes during distillation if traces of air are present. Toxic by inhalation and by skin absorption. Corrosive to tissue. Produces toxic oxides of nitrogen during combustion. Used as a rocket propellant and in fuel cells.
Regulatory Data
A release of this material at or above its CERCLA reportable quantity (1 lb) requires immediate notification to the National Response Center at 800-424-8802.
Special Provisions
49 CFR 172.102 special provision codes for this entry: B16, B53, T10, TP2, TP13. These codes modify the general requirements (packaging, quantity limits, exceptions) for this specific material. Look up each code in 49 CFR 172.102 for the full text.
